Attorney: Green Township doctor in opioid case 'broke the law with good intentions'

By Cincinnati Enquirer  
   February 26, 2021

For nearly 40 years, Dr. George Griffin ran a solo medical practice in Green Township. Many of his patients were working class people who had been injured on the job and needed to return to work, according to his attorneys. But prosecutors say Griffin, an orthopedic surgeon, prescribed massive and dangerous amounts of pain medications without a legitimate medical purpose and didn't follow accepted guidelines for using opiates to control pain.
